Are you a passionate and qualified Level 3 Teaching Assistant looking for an exciting opportunity in a welcoming and supportive primary school?

We are currently recruiting for a full-time Level 3 Teaching Assistant to join our team in Rugby, providing valuable support across Key Stage 1 (KS1).

Key Responsibilities:

Work closely with class teachers to provide support and assistance in KS1 classrooms.

Help plan and deliver engaging lessons and activities that promote positive learning outcomes for all pupils.

Provide tailored support to students with Special Educational Needs (SEN) within a mainstream setting.

Assist with classroom management and creating a positive, inclusive learning environment.

Support small groups and individual students, helping to boost academic progress and confidence.

Monitor and record pupil progress, contributing to teacher assessments and reports.

Requirements:

Level 3 Teaching Assistant qualification (or equivalent) is essential.

Experience working with KS1 students in a primary school setting.

A positive, proactive, and flexible approach to supporting children's learning and development.

A willingness to support SEN pupils in a mainstream environment.

An Enhanced DBS check on the Update Service (or the willingness to apply for one).
